Welcome to TDR. The biggest impact of intake and exhaust upgrades is definitely EGT reduction. Beyond that, they lower restriction in the exhaust system allowing the engine to "breathe" easier and make more horsepower. This may not be noticeable on a stock truck, but will definitely help when BOMBs are included. There are many good exhaust systems available. If your horsepower aspirations are modest, 4" should be plenty. Otherwise, 5" is also available.
